I have a query on incomplete triangle (latest diagonal being incomplete).
Let us suppose that we have a cumulative incurred triangle (annual triangle) where the latest diagonal has only 8 months data in it. I thought to apply 8-12, 20-24, 32-36 month development factors respectively for the latest diagonal from the previous years data, which gives me an yearly triangle - now being used as input triangle, for which I want to apply Chain ladder method for Ultimate.
But my friend says that we should use 8-20, 20-32, 32-44 etc development factors from the previous year triangles and develop them to ultimate, But I am not convinced with it. Can you please help me understand which is the better methodology to use --- from reserving viewpoint and if possible from pricing viewpoint.
